Synopsis
This book/disk text provides self-paced, step-by-step lessons in a popular computerized accounting program, using cases to reinforce basic accounting concepts. Coverage encompasses getting started, setting up a business' accounting system, cash-oriented business activities, other business activities, adjusting entries, budgeting, reporting business activities, and debits and credits. Learning features include an ongoing case, screen captures and examples, and question and answer sections. Owen teaches accounting and information systems at Allan Hancock College and at the University of California- Santa Barbara.
